WebCreated by the Illinois General Assembly in 1939, the Teachers’ Retirement System of the State of Illinois (TRS) provides retirement, disability and death benefits for certified … WebThe first state-run pension plan in Illinois, for Chicago teachers, was launched in 1895, but others began decades later. In the 1990s, the five state-run funds made two separate but significant changes to pensions. One included increasing …

Retirement security for Illinois educators is the primary goal of the TRS Board of Trustees and the underlying principle in the evaluation of all legislative proposals. In order to provide this security, adequate funding is necessary to meet the requirements of the Illinois Pension Code. Funding must be provided ...
